SMITH, Fay Jackson. Captain of the Phantom Presidio. A History of the Presidio of Fronteras, Sonora, New Spain, 1686-1735, including the inspection by Brigadier Pedro de Rivera, 1726. Spokane: Arthur H. Clark Company, 1993. Illus. 217pp. Fine in d/j. The notoriously corrupt Don Gregorio Alvarez Tunon y Quiros ruled the Presidio of Fronteras and surrounding area with an iron fist until finally unmasked in 1726. $29.50[a].

Outstanding missionary, intrepid explorer, colonizer, rancher, cattleman, cartographer, and savant, Eusebio Kino (1645-1711) spent a most active life in Sonora and Arizona, founding the first Spanish missions there.
